**Ticket: Consent banner config drift — Plinth web tier**

Prod and canary disagree on banner variant after last week's Glimmerline rollout. Canary still serves the old opt-in copy; prod has the granular toggle set. Root cause: manual hotfix on canary never landed in the repo. Rollout blocked until reconciled. Needs owner by Thursday sync. Values currently live on canary are as follows.

config for tawif-bagef:
[sorwyn]
team = sorys
access_code = ac_9ba40c
host = sorwyn.ordingrid.local
port = 5000
owner = aldok.quenion
peer = belath.paliqcloud.local

# Approvals — TilePloy Map-Tile Prefetcher

TilePloy prefetches map tiles for the Wayfarer app based on predicted routes. Any change to prefetch radius, cache eviction, or upstream tile quotas requires written approval, since misconfiguration can exhaust bandwidth budgets overnight. Submit changes through the standard review queue and obtain sign-off from the responsible maintainer named below.

signatory, tageg-hahof: Ralion Kelion Fraael

**14:22 — Reset flow cutover**

Heads up, plugin folks: this is when we flipped Lockhatch's new password reset flow live. Old reset links minted before cutover kept working for 15 minutes, then started 410ing, which is why some of your embedded flows showed the weird error page. The deploy that caused it is identified by the trace token below.

session token of tajef-bageg = htk21_5d90d574934f3ccae6437

Action item from the Brindlemoor autocomplete incident: the widget fired a lookup on every keystroke, saturating the suggestion service during the Tuesday release. We will introduce client-side debouncing, a minimum query length, and a capped retry policy, all gated behind a config flag so the release manager can roll back quickly. The proposed tuning constants are as follows.

tuning constants:
QUOTAS = {
    "druwyn": 5,
    "holix": 5,
    "zorath": 5,
    "holwyn": 10,
}